最近几天hermes-agent爱马仕的文章漫天飞, 都在说取代openclaw龙虾。 不试一试怎么有发言权呢。 hermes-agent GitHub 仓库:https://github.com/nousresearch/hermes-agent , 不得不说这个star增长得有点猛。 先说下hermes-agent是什么。 一句话:它是一个自主学习进化智能体,执行任务时间越久,能力就越强。 说下和其他传统agent的差异: Hermes Agent 的核心差异在于其 “自我改进”能力。它不仅是一个能执行任务的代理,更是一个能从每次交互中学习的智能系统。 下面下面说下安装步骤: curl -fsSL https://raw.githubusercontent.com/NousResearch/hermes-agent/main/scripts/install.sh
如果你还不了解 Hermes Agent,或尚未在 Lighthouse 中部署 Hermes Agent,建议先参考 《玩转 Hermes Agent|使用 Lighthouse 快速部署云上 Hermes 如果尚未部署,参考 《使用 Lighthouse 快速部署云上 Hermes Agent》你已在 Hermes Agent 配置面板中完成模型(Models)配置。 若尚未配置,参考总教程的 「步骤二:配置模型」 云上 Hermes Agent 接入飞书场景推荐使用国内地域的 Lighthouse 实例与国内模型服务。 需要通过"重装系统"选择最新的 Hermes Agent 应用模板升级,具体参考总教程的 「方式二:重装一台现有的 Lighthouse」。重装会清空服务器内数据,如有重要内容请先备份。2. Hermes Agent 实践教程,如一键部署 Hermes Agent、配置模型、接入微信/QQ、安装并使用技能(Skills)等,欢迎查看 Hermes Agent 部署总教程。
如果你还不了解 Hermes Agent,或尚未在 Lighthouse 中部署 Hermes Agent,建议先参考 《玩转 Hermes Agent|使用 Lighthouse 快速部署云上 Hermes 若尚未配置,参考总教程的 「步骤二:配置模型」 云上 Hermes Agent 接入 QQ 场景推荐使用国内地域的 Lighthouse 实例与国内模型服务。 需要通过"重装系统"选择最新的 Hermes Agent 应用模板升级,具体参考总教程的 「方式二:重装一台现有的 Lighthouse」。重装会清空服务器内数据,如有重要内容请先备份。6. 服务器使用 Hermes Agent 命令行工具进行测试(参考总教程「常见问题」章节) 找不到 AppSecret 怎么办AppSecret 仅在创建时完整显示一次。 更多教程更多云上 Hermes Agent 实践教程,如一键部署 Hermes Agent、配置模型、接入微信/飞书、安装并使用技能(Skills)等,欢迎查看 Hermes Agent 部署总教程。
Hermes采用语义化版本(v0.9.0),表明仍处于积极开发阶段,尚未达到语义化1.0的成熟度。 、TUI、ControlUI(Web)文档hermes-agent.nousresearch.com/docs+docs/目录docs/目录+VISION.md+CLAUDE.md+AGENTS.md开发模式 ↓Honchodialectic→用户建模("whoyouare")↓周期性Nudge→记忆持久化提示Agent-curatedmemory:Agent主动决定哪些信息值得记住Skills自创建:完成复杂任务后 自主创建Skills的机制架构洞察:Hermes的记忆系统是"主动学习型"——Agent自己决定学什么、如何学。 这代表了两种不同的AIAgent哲学:Hermes追求Agent的自主性,OpenClaw追求可控性和集成性。
配置文件位置与作用HermesAgent的所有配置文件默认存放在~/.hermes/目录下:~/.hermes/config.yaml:主配置文件,定义模型、工具、安全策略、个性化设置等。 ~/.hermes/.env:环境变量文件,专门用于存储敏感信息,如各大模型提供商的APIKey。~/.hermes/state.db:SQLite数据库,存储会话状态和记忆。 ~/.hermes/skills/:存放Agent自主学习或手动安装的技能(Skills)。最佳实践:永远不要将.env文件提交到Git等代码仓库中,以防止APIKey泄露。 ⚙️第二部分:高级功能配置详解1.个性化Agent人格您可以通过personalities字段为Agent定义不同的人格,然后在聊天时用/personality<name>切换。 只需在您的项目根目录下创建.hermes/config.yaml文件,它会覆盖全局的~/.hermes/config.yaml。
一、什么是 Hermes AgentHermes Agent 是由 Nous Research 于 2026 年 2 月推出的开源自主 AI 智能体框架。 核心定位不同于传统的 IDE 辅助工具或简单的聊天机器人封装,Hermes Agent 是一个驻留于服务器端的长期进化系统。 输入 Y 后回车,如配置正确将看到欢迎界面: 提示:后续在终端中与 Hermes 对话,直接运行 hermes 即可。发送测试消息:如有回复,则部署成功!接入企业微信等聊天工具可参考其他教程。 三、Hermes Agent vs OpenClaw 对比3.1 核心参数对比 维度OpenClaw(小龙虾)Hermes Agent(爱马仕)出品方OpenClaw 团队Nous Research 研究人员Hermes Agent支持 RL 训练集成,批量轨迹生成能力
点此即可享»轻量应用服务器专属优惠«,快速部署Hermes Agent,支持接入微信、企业微信、飞书、钉钉等主流聊天平台。 1、新手必看:Hermes Agent一键部署教程标题链接玩转Hermes Agent|使用Lighthouse快速部署云上Hermes Agent(初次上手Lighthouse部署读这篇)https: /docs/overview2、实操必看:Hermes Agent接入聊天软件标题链接云上 Hermes Agent 快速接入微信指南Lighthouse:https://cloud.tencent.com /docs/configuration/channel-qq云上 Hermes Agent 快速接入飞书指南Lighthouse:https://cloud.tencent.com/developer/ :· Hermes Agent官方文档:点这里· Hermes Agent官方技能市场:点这里
这里需要注意:用户改为agentuser然后再点击登录终端输入下方命令就可以进行配置引导hermessetup前两步是配置OpenClaw是否转移到hermes,直接输入Y就可以这里直接回车,下一步到模型配置这里以朋友搭建的
本文融合多版本官方教程的核心优势,覆盖全系统部署方案,帮助你轻松搭建好专属智能体。 :latest#创建本地配置目录(持久化数据)mkdir-p~/.hermes/docker-config#启动容器(后台运行,映射8080端口)dockerrun-d\--namehermes-agent \-v~/.hermes/docker-config:/root/.hermes\-p8080:8080\nousresearch/hermes-agent:latest#查看运行状态dockerps| :#克隆仓库gitclonehttps://github.com/NousResearch/hermes-agent.gitcdhermes-agent#创建并激活虚拟环境python3.11-mvenvvenvsourcevenv /hermes-agent:latest七、进阶使用指引日常任务体验:让Hermes协助处理文件整理、代码编写、系统运维等熟悉的任务,观察其推理和执行流程自定义技能:进入~/.hermes/skills
1、介绍(Introduction)Hermes Agent 是由 Nous Research 开发的一款自我进化型智能助手。 配合智能用户界面与多平台集成支持,Hermes Agent 能为用户提供从本地开发到云端部署的全方位、持续进化的智能辅助体验。 3、设置(Setup)Hermes Agent 与 OpenAI API 标准兼容,从而实现快速集成。一键下载和安装命令:请输入你的 sudo 密码以确认下载依赖项。进入快速设置。 获取的 API 密钥通过 Hermes Agent 选择要调用的模型。按 Enter 键自动检测上下文长度。你可以选择是否与你的消息平台集成。来自 Hermes Agent 的提示。 输入“Y”开始与 Hermes Agent 对话。
如果你也想要同时体验OpenClaw,也可以参考我们的教程来进行部署。Hermes Agent适合安装在哪里? (Channels)为 Hermes Agent 配置聊天通道,此处以微信为例配置技能(Skills)为 Hermes Agent 安装一个技能来扩展能力,此处以 self-improving-agent 为例验证对话在微信中与 Hermes Agent 开始对话基于应用模板一键安装Hermes Agent对于腾讯云Lighthouse的用户而言,可以通过两种方式来基于应用模板安装Hermes Agent 为Hermes Agent配置模型和通道Hermes Agent 安装完成后,我们还需要为它配置三个核心模块才能正常使用:模型(Models):Hermes Agent 本身不包含AI模型,需要连接一个外部大语言模型 如果你在应用管理页看到的不是这个三栏配置面板,而是一个只展示"应用内软件信息"(Hermes Agent 版本号、官方文档和实践教程链接)的简化页面,则说明你的 Hermes Agent 应用模板版本较旧
ℹ️说明:HermesAgent的配置文件存放在~/.hermes/目录下。 其中APIKey等密钥信息保存在~/.hermes/.env,模型和提供商设置保存在~/.hermes/config.yaml。使用hermesconfigset命令会自动将值写入正确的文件。 编辑~/.hermes/config.yaml:展开代码语言:YAMLAI代码解释model_aliases:opus:model:claude-opus-4-6provider:anthropicds A:运行hermesconfig查看当前配置,或直接运行hermes开始对话,欢迎界面会显示当前模型。Q:可以同时配置多个提供商吗? 更多教程HermesAgent官方文档HermesAgent一键部署指南AIProviders完整配置参考本地LLM部署指南(Mac)
一、前言 Hermes Agent 是由 Nous Research 开源的自我进化型 AI Agent。 二、整体架构 Hermes Agent 采用"一体双入口 + 多后端"的模块化架构: 入口层:提供两类交互入口。 六、部署与运行 Hermes Agent 支持 Linux、macOS、WSL2 以及通过 Termux 运行的 Android,通过一行 bash 脚本即可安装。 七、小结 Hermes Agent 以"可自我进化的自治代理"为核心命题,通过技能系统、分层记忆、MCP 工具生态、子代理并行、Cron 自动化与多平台网关,构建出一个区别于传统 IDE 内嵌助手的长周期 对于需要跨平台、跨会话持续协作,并希望在使用过程中沉淀可复用能力的团队和研究者,Hermes Agent 提供了一条开源、可定制且面向研究的落地路径。
如果你还不了解 Hermes Agent,或尚未在 Lighthouse 中部署 Hermes Agent,建议先参考 《玩转 Hermes Agent|使用 Lighthouse 快速部署云上 Hermes 如果尚未部署,参考 《使用 Lighthouse 快速部署云上 Hermes Agent》你已在 Hermes Agent 配置面板中完成模型(Models)配置(否则机器人收到消息也无法生成回复)。 若尚未配置,参考总教程的 「步骤二:配置模型」 云上 Hermes Agent 接入微信场景推荐使用国内地域的 Lighthouse 实例与国内模型服务。 需要通过"重装系统"选择最新的 Hermes Agent 应用模板升级,具体参考总教程的 「方式二:重装一台现有的 Lighthouse」。重装会清空服务器内数据,如有重要内容请先备份。2. Hermes Agent 实践教程,如一键部署 Hermes Agent、配置模型、接入 QQ/飞书、安装并使用技能(Skills)等,欢迎查看 Hermes Agent 部署总教程。
特别提示:国内用户注意,本教程推荐搭配Kimi大模型使用,无需特殊网络,中文理解和智能体任务表现出色。 主流平台一键安装(推荐)1、Linux/macOS/WSL2(最稳定)#官方脚本(全球通用)curl-fsSLhttps://raw.githubusercontent.com/NousResearch/hermes-agent 三、手动安装(适合开发者/高级用户)1、克隆仓库(含子模块)gitclone--recurse-submoduleshttps://github.com/NousResearch/hermes-agent.gitcdhermes-agent bashrc#或source~/.zshrchermes--version四、Docker安装(适合隔离环境)#克隆仓库gitclonehttps://github.com/NousResearch/hermes-agent.gitcdhermes-agent #运行容器(映射配置目录)mkdir-p~/.hermesdockerrun-it-v~/.hermes:/root/.hermeshermes-agent优势:环境隔离,不影响主机系统,适合测试不同版本
之前分享过Openclaw的记忆哲学:Clawdbot的记忆设计哲学 用过Hermes的人都会认同它是一个越用越聪明的Agent。 最新的罗永浩十字路口,重新访谈了李想。 先说Hermes Agent的记忆设计。 Hermes Agent记忆系统分为四层。 第一层:持久化记忆(memory.md、user.md)。 再说Hermes Agent的技能设计。 agent会将解决完复杂问题之后的知识,沉淀为技能实现从经验中学习。 Hermes是一套自学习的Agent,在完成一个任务后,会自我评估,将有效的解题思路封装为一个skill.md文档,存入~/.hermes/skills/目录下。 我更倾向于Hermes这种记忆设计的方案,可控性和效率更高。但如果哪一天我们的agent变成了一个人形机器人,可能Openclaw这种全文记忆更合适一些,因为这样它会更了解你。
而国内用户注意,本教程推荐搭配 Kimi 大模型使用,无需特殊网络,中文理解和智能体任务表现出色。 克隆仓库git clone https://github.com/NousResearch/hermes-agent.gitcd hermes-agent# 3. 创建配置目录并链接mkdir -p ~/.hermesln -s $(pwd) ~/.hermes/hermes-agent# 6. /gpt-4o3、启动 Hermes Agent# 启动CLI交互hermes# 启动Web UI(后台运行)hermes web start# 查看Web UI地址hermes web status四 、常见问题与解决方案五、更新与卸载1、更新 Hermes Agent# 一键更新hermes update# 源码更新(手动安装版)cd ~/.hermes/hermes-agentgit pulluv
核心命令展开代码语言:BashAI代码解释#查看主Agent的实时日志hermeslogs#查看网关(Gateway)的实时日志(如果你在用飞书/微信)hermesgatewaylogs提示:hermeslogs 展开代码语言:BashAI代码解释#在hermes交互界面或终端中,手动重新指定模型/modelopenai/gpt-4o这个命令会强制Hermes重新加载模型配置,绕过可能存在的环境变量初始化问题。 如果你直接用系统的pip安装包,这些包并不会进入Hermes的虚拟环境,因此无法被识别。解决方案必须将依赖安装到Hermes自己的虚拟环境中。 找到Hermes的虚拟环境路径:展开代码语言:BashAI代码解释#通常可以通过以下方式找到whichhermes#输出可能是:/home/username/.local/bin/hermes#那么venv 展开代码语言:BashAI代码解释#重新运行官方安装脚本即可完成升级curl-fsSLhttps://raw.githubusercontent.com/NousResearch/hermes-agent
的全系统安装教程以及Kimi大模型配置流程(一)准备工作系统要求:Linux/macOS/WSL2(推荐),Windows10+(PowerShell7+),Android(Termux)依赖条件:安装脚本会自动处理 主流安装方式(推荐)1.Linux/macOS/WSL2一键安装(官方推荐)#执行一键安装脚本curl-fsSLhttps://raw.githubusercontent.com/NousResearch/hermes-agent Windows原生安装(EarlyBeta)打开PowerShell7+(管理员模式):#执行安装命令iex(irmhttps://raw.githubusercontent.com/NousResearch/hermes-agent (三)高级安装方式1.源码手动安装(适合开发者)#克隆仓库gitclonehttps://github.com/NousResearch/hermes-agent.gitcdhermes-agent#创建并激活虚拟环境 pkgupgrade-ypkginstallgitpythonnodejsripgrepffmpegbuild-essentialgitclonehttps://github.com/NousResearch/hermes-agent.gitcdhermes-agentpython-mvenvvenvsourcevenv
Node.js18+:展开代码语言:BashAI代码解释brewinstallpython@3.12node步骤2:一键安装HermesAgent展开代码语言:BashAI代码解释curl-fsSLhttps://hermes-agent.org sudoaptupgrade-ysudoaptinstall-ypython3.12python3.12-venvnodejsnpmgitripgrep步骤2:一键安装展开代码语言:BashAI代码解释curl-fsSLhttps://hermes-agent.org sudoaptupdate&&sudoaptupgrade-ysudoaptinstall-ypython3.12python3.12-venvnodejsnpmgitripgrepcurl-fsSLhttps://hermes-agent.org 详细教程:玩转HermesAgent|使用Lighthouse快速部署云上HermesAgent。快速上手HermesAgent:仅需三步轻松安装想要体验HermesAgent的强大能力? 建议先用curl-fsSLhttps://hermes-agent.org/install.sh|less审查脚本内容。Q2:安装后配置文件在哪里?